What's left behind the scenes

  • The entire film was shot on location without any studio filming.
  • Gary Buesy came up with and wrote the monologue about how his character got his scar himself. The script included several scenes where the character played by Rutger Hauer (1944-2019) asserted his authority over the others, simply reminding them of the need to follow the rules he had established. Initially, it was supposed to be during a dinner scene that he would put Buesy's character in his place. On the day the rehearsal was scheduled, Buesy came up with a lengthy monologue (it took up two pages of text) about his dog, which he wanted to try out. Hauer initially thought that Buesy was simply “hogging the spotlight” (since the scene was originally intended to focus on his character), and called Buesy’s story “complete nonsense” – which wasn’t in the script and greatly embarrassed Buesy. Nevertheless, Buesy’s monologue made such an impression on the director and the other actors that it was left in the film, while Hauer’s line was cut.
